Specifications
Series: 7000, AGASTAT
Part Status: Active
Lead Free Status / RoHS Status: --
Relay Type: Mechanical Relay
Moisture Sensitivity Level (MSL): --
Function: On-Delay
Circuit: DPDT (2 Form C)
Delay Time: 0.5 Sec ~ 5 Sec
Contact Rating @ Voltage: 10A @ 240VAC
Voltage - Supply: 125VDC
Mounting Type: Panel Mount
Termination Style: Screw Terminal
Timing Adjustment Method: Hand Dial
Timing Initiate Method: Input Voltage

Time Delay Relays typically have an input, in this case a 7012PB, and at least one output. Initially, the output is inactive, or off. When the input is activated, the timer starts counting down a predetermined amount of time that was programmed into it. When this time has elapsed, the output is activated. As soon as the input is again deactivated, the output will become inactive, or off. This provides a delay between the activation of the input and the activation of the output.

A 7012PB time delay relay differs from a regular relay in that the connection from the relay contacts to the load does not stay active as long as the input is active. Instead the contacts open and close according to the pre-programmed time delay. This helps to prevent equipment from potentially malfunctioning due to a short circuit or overload when a single switch is used to control multiple loads.

Time delay relays such as the 7012PB are used in a wide variety of applications, including elevators, motors, pumps, lighting control, HVAC systems, and in many other industrial uses. In elevators, for example, these relays can be used to control the movement of the elevator as it transitions from floor to floor and to protect the motor from potentially overheating due to idling for long periods of time. In lighting control, these relays can be used to delay the start or stop time of fluorescent and incandescent lights and to provide power to fixtures after the switch has been activated.
